How to stop sensitive WhatsApp images from appearing in your phone’s gallery

How to stop sensitive WhatsApp images from appearing in your phone’s gallery. This is worse if you are a member of many WhatsApp groups. Some people like to send graphic pictures from the scenes of accidents while some may even send lewd images, although, for the most part,  this is usually by accident rather than by design.

If you use the auto-download media feature on WhatsApp you may occasionally get annoyed, shocked or angry with some of the pictures and videos that would have been downloaded from WhatsApp into your phone’s gallery.

If you have been wondering how to stop photos and videos from automatically saving in your phone’s gallery so that your gallery remains “clean”, do not worry, there are several methods you can use to do so.

To stop media from all your individual chats and groups from being saved

 

  1. Open WhatsApp.
  2. Tap More options

  1. Select Settings
  2. Select Chats         
  3. Turn off Media visibility.

When you turn off media visibility, all images/videos that WhatsApp downloads will no longer appear in the phone’s gallery.

The images/videos will still remain on the phone, however,  and users who know what they are doing can still display them. The feature is useful if you want to keep your gallery clean.

To stop images/video from a particular individual or group from being saved

  1. Open the individual chat or group whose images/video you don’t want to appear in your phone’s gallery.
  2. Tap More options 
  3. Select View contact or Group info.
    • Alternatively, tap the contact’s name or group subject.
  4. Select Media visibility
  5. Select No when the “Do you want to show newly downloaded media from this chat in your phone’s gallery” prompt is displayed.
  6. Select OK to complete the process.

New media that is sent to you by that particular contact or group will still get downloaded by WhatsApp but will not be displayed in the phone’s Gallery application anymore.

Creating a .nomedia file

Alternatively, you can create a .nomedia file in the WhatsApp images folder. Please note this will hide all your WhatsApp photos from your phone’s gallery.

  1. Download ES File Explorer from the Google Play Store.
  2. In ES File Explorer, go to Images/WhatsApp Images/.
  3. Tape the Menu button followed by New  followed by File
  4. Create a file named .nomedia, including the period.

If you want to view your photos in your phone’s gallery later, simply delete the nomedia file.
